In this study, an experiment was conducted to examine the AVL research diesel engine using two kinds of waterdiesel (W-D) fuel microemulsions. These W-D mixtures contained 3.5 and 7.0% by volume (%, v/v) of distilled
water dispersed in regular diesel fuel meeting the requirements of the EN590 standard. The engine was tested
under the conditions of low, moderate and higher loads. This research was focused on the emission characteristics
of nitrogen dioxide (NO2
) and nitrogen monoxide (NO). Cumulative emission of NOx
was also analyzed before
being further discussed. The obtained results of this study showed that the addition of distilled water to the regular
diesel fuel has a minor effect on the variation of the nitrogen oxides emission. It was confirmed that NO is the main
component of NOx
detected in the exhaust stream of the AVL engine fuelled with all tested fuels. It proves that the
thermal mechanism of the nitrogen oxides formation was dominant in the combustion process. Moreover, it was
found that the addition of water dispersed as microemulsion in diesel fuel had a minor effect on the reduction of
the NOx
emission.
